From 5891a3fbf664ed9f80b70d3e1348e0fe3c7c786e Mon Sep 17 00:00:00 2001 From: Roman Safronov Date: Thu, 31 Oct 2024 13:40:38 +0200 Subject: [PATCH] Add telemetry metricStorage for NFV --- examples/va/nfv/ovs-dpdk-sriov/service-values.yaml | 2 ++ va/nfv/ovs-dpdk-sriov/kustomization.yaml | 11 +++++++++++ 2 files changed, 13 insertions(+) diff --git a/examples/va/nfv/ovs-dpdk-sriov/service-values.yaml b/examples/va/nfv/ovs-dpdk-sriov/service-values.yaml index 33f407be4..fa27780e4 100644 --- a/examples/va/nfv/ovs-dpdk-sriov/service-values.yaml +++ b/examples/va/nfv/ovs-dpdk-sriov/service-values.yaml @@ -56,6 +56,8 @@ data: template: ceilometer: enabled: true + metricStorage: + enabled: true extraMounts: - name: v1 region: r1 diff --git a/va/nfv/ovs-dpdk-sriov/kustomization.yaml b/va/nfv/ovs-dpdk-sriov/kustomization.yaml index 3bb52f53b..7df9a8f1c 100644 --- a/va/nfv/ovs-dpdk-sriov/kustomization.yaml +++ b/va/nfv/ovs-dpdk-sriov/kustomization.yaml @@ -106,6 +106,17 @@ replacements: - spec.telemetry.template.ceilometer.enabled options: create: true + - source: + kind: ConfigMap + name: service-values + fieldPath: data.telemetry.template.metricStorage + targets: + - select: + kind: OpenStackControlPlane + fieldPaths: + - spec.telemetry.template.metricStorage + options: + create: true - source: kind: ConfigMap name: service-values